Overview
Macan is a terraced cottage located near the village of Ambleside in Cumbria. Hosting one king-size bedroom and a shower room, this property can sleep up to two people. Inside you will also find an open-plan living area with kitchen, dining area and sitting area with balcony. To the outside is roadside parking for one car and a balcony. Situated in a pleasant village location and close to scenic attractions, Macan is a lovely cottage in a delightful part of England.
Amenities
Biomass central heating. TV with Freeview, WiFi. Fuel and power inc. in rent. Bed linen and towels inc. in rent. Travel cot and highchair to be requested 14 days prior to arrival and are subject to availability. Allocated roadside parking for 1 car. Balcony. One well-behaved dog welcome. Sorry, no smoking. Shop 1.5 miles via ferry and Hawkshead – 4 miles, pub 1 mile. 4pm check in. Note: Children must be supervised at all times due to balcony. This property have a good house keeping bond of £75. Pick-up and drop-off ferry point situated approx 100 yards away. During seasonal peaks the ferry service may be in high demand due to its popularity. Sykes are not responsible for the council ferry changes to service, times, and closures. The ferry service can be affected by extreme weather conditions
By booking this property, you are automatically enrolled as a member of the Freshwater Biological Association for the duration of your stay.
Accommodation
One king-size double bedroom. Shower room with basin and WC. Open plan living area with kitchen, Electric oven and hob, microwave, fridge, washer/dryer, dishwasher, Dining area and sitting area with balcony
